GitHub是一个广泛使用的代码托管平台,开发者可以在上面分享和协作开发项目。在使用GitHub时,很多用户可能会遇到下载项目的需求。然而,下载的方式和选项并不是固定的,本文将为你提供一个详细的指南,帮助你了解如何在GitHub上更换下载方式。
目录
什么是GitHub下载?
在GitHub上,下载指的是从GitHub平台将项目代码或资源下载到本地计算机的过程。用户可以根据需求选择不同的下载方式,便于本地查看、修改或协作开发。
GitHub下载的常见方式
GitHub提供了多种下载方式,用户可以根据自己的需求和习惯选择合适的方法。以下是最常见的几种下载方式:
直接下载ZIP文件
- 访问项目页面。
- 点击绿色的“Code”按钮。
- 选择“Download ZIP”。
这种方式适合不熟悉Git命令的用户,因为只需要点击几下就可以下载整个项目的压缩包。
使用Git克隆
使用Git工具可以将项目克隆到本地。步骤如下:
- 安装Git工具。
- 在项目页面点击绿色“Code”按钮,复制克隆链接。
- 打开命令行工具,输入命令: bash git clone <克隆链接>
这种方式可以实现版本控制,并方便后续的更新。
通过命令行下载
对于熟悉命令行的用户,可以使用curl或wget命令直接下载。示例:
bash curl -L -O <文件链接>
这种方式适合批量下载或脚本自动化。
如何更换下载方式
在网页界面更换下载方式
如果你想更改下载方式,可以简单地返回项目页面,再次点击绿色的“Code”按钮,选择新的下载选项。比如,从ZIP下载切换到使用Git克隆。
使用不同的命令行工具
根据个人习惯,用户可以在命令行中选择使用不同的工具下载。例如,如果使用Git,可以使用以下命令进行克隆:
bash git clone <项目链接>
如果需要,可以切换到其他工具如wget或curl,方便批量下载。
常见问题解答
GitHub下载的速度慢,怎么办?
- 尝试使用代理工具,提高下载速度。
- 检查网络连接,确保稳定。
- 尝试在不同的时间段进行下载,避开高峰期。
如何下载GitHub项目的特定版本?
- 在项目页面,找到“Releases”选项,选择所需的版本下载。
- 使用Git,可以通过命令行检出特定版本: bash git checkout <版本号>
可以批量下载GitHub上的项目吗?
- 可以使用脚本配合Git命令来实现批量下载。
- 例如,使用bash脚本和数组循环下载多个项目。
为什么不能下载某些项目?
- 某些项目可能设置了私有权限,仅限于特定用户访问。
- 确保你有相应的访问权限,如果是私有项目,需获取所有者的授权。
GitHub下载的文件是否有病毒?
- GitHub本身是一个代码托管平台,文件上传后经过一定的审核,但仍建议用户自行使用安全软件扫描下载的文件。
以上是关于如何在GitHub上更换下载方式的全面介绍。希望通过本文的解读,能够帮助用户更高效地利用GitHub进行项目管理和代码下载。
正文完